Transaction 667aa4dacc46211778f50c16b2039f34bd5dcedce2e73ad57dc0040ceed68d86

2 Input
2 Outputs
  • 667aa4dacc46211778f50c16b2039f34bd5dcedce2e73ad57dc0040ceed68d86:0
  • value  1074906
    address  113iw1h1yVgTcschqgTQ57RThve8twHmFk
  • 667aa4dacc46211778f50c16b2039f34bd5dcedce2e73ad57dc0040ceed68d86:1
  • value  6725512
    address  39FLJVYtVkgsfn1A5rc7QoqoWDz6fcL5ih